Introduction
Hard water is water which contains high levels of dissolved minerals, mostly calcium and magnesium. These minerals are safe to human health but can damage plumbing framework in time. Allow's explore exactly how difficult water influences pipes and what you can do regarding it.
Effect on Pipes
Hard water impacts pipes in a number of harmful means, largely with range build-up, reduced water circulation, and raised corrosion.
Scale Build-up
One of one of the most usual problems brought on by hard water is scale build-up inside pipes and fixtures. As water streams via the plumbing system, minerals speed up out and stick to the pipeline walls. In time, this buildup can narrow pipe openings, resulting in minimized water circulation and enhanced stress on the system.
Lowered Water Flow
Natural resources from hard water can slowly reduce the size of pipelines, limiting water circulation to taps, showers, and devices. This lowered flow not only affects water stress but likewise boosts power intake as home appliances like hot water heater need to function more challenging to supply the same quantity of warm water.
What is Hard Water?
Hard water is identified by its mineral content, particularly cal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als get in the supply of water as it percolates with sedimentary rock and chalk deposits underground. When tough water is heated or delegated stand, it has a tendency to create range, a crusty accumulation that follows surfaces and can trigger a variety of issues in plumbing systems.
Rust
While tough water minerals themselves do not trigger rust, they can exacerbate existing corrosion issues in pipelines. Scale buildup can trap water against metal surface areas, speeding up the corrosion procedure and possibly bring about leakages or pipeline failure over time.

Water Conditioners
Water softeners are the most common option for treating hard water. They function by trading calcium and magnesium ions with salt or potassium ions, efficiently decreasing the solidity of the water.
Other Treatment Alternatives
Along with water softeners, other therapy options consist of mag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ical additives. Each technique has its benefits and viability depending upon the extent of the tough water problem and home requirements.

Understanding Hard Water. Hard water contains high levels of minerals, particularly calcium and magnesium, which are naturally present in the water supply. When hard water flows through your plumbing system, these minerals can accumulate over time, causing various issues. This mineral buildup, known as scale, can clog pipes, reduce water flow, and impair the efficiency of plumbing fixtures and appliances. Recognizing the Signs of Hard Water. To determine if you have hard water, there are several signs to look out for. These include soap scum residue on surfaces, stained fixtures, reduced water flow, and increased energy bills. If you notice these signs in your Dallas home, it is likely that you are dealing with hard water issues. The Impact of Hard Water on Plumbing Fixtures and Appliances. Hard water can have detrimental effects on plumbing fixtures and appliances. The accumulation of mineral deposits can lead to reduced lifespan, decreased efficiency, clogged pipes, and increased maintenance and repair costs. Over time, these issues can result in costly repairs and replacements if not addressed promptly. Solutions for Hard Water Issues. There are effective solutions available to combat the impact of hard water on your plumbing system in Dallas. Consider the following options: Water Softeners: Water softeners are devices that remove the minerals responsible for hardness from the water. Water softeners work by utilizing a process called ion exchange to replace the cal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, effectively reducing the hardness of the water. Softened water not only helps prevent scale buildup but also leaves your skin and hair feeling smoother, prolongs the lifespan of your plumbing fixtures and appliances, and reduces the need for excessive cleaning. Descaling Agents: Descaling agents are products specifically designed to dissolve and remove mineral deposits from plumbing fixtures and appliances. These agents can be effective in addressing existing scale buildup and preventing further accumulation. When using descaling agents, it’s important to follow the instructions provided and take necessary precautions to ensure safety.
